JEE Advanced2010PhysicsCenter of Mass, Momentum and CollisionActual

A point mass of 1 ~kg collides elastically with a stationary point mass of 5 ~kg . After their collision, the 1 ~kg mass reverses its direction and moves with a speed of 2 ~ms ⁻¹ . Which of the following statement(s) is/are correct for the system of these two masses?

Options

  1. ATotal momentum of the system is 3 ~kg - ms ⁻¹
  2. BMomentum of 5 ~kg mass after collision is 4 ~kg - ms ⁻¹
  3. CKinetic energy of the centre of mass is 0.75 ~J
  4. DTotal kinetic energy of the system is 4 ~J

Correct answer

A. Total momentum of the system is 3 ~kg - ms ⁻¹

Step-by-step solution

aligned & v₁^ = ( m₁-m₅ m₁+m₅ ) v₁+ ( 2 m₅ m₁+m₅ ) v₅ & -2= ( 1-5 1+5 ) v₁+0 ( as v₅=0 ) & v₁=3 ~ms ⁻¹ & v₅^ = ( m₅-m₁ m₁+m₅ ) v₅+ ( 2 m₁ m₁+m₂ ) v₁ & =0+ ( 2 1 6 )(3)=1 ~ms ⁻¹ & P_ CM =P_i=(1)(3) & =3 kg - m s & P₅ ^ =(5)(1)=5 kg - m 5 & K_ CM = P_ CM ^2 2 M_ CM & = 9 2 6 =0.75 ~J & K_ total = 1 2 1 (3)^2 & =4.5 ~J & aligned correct options are (a) and (c).
